betway体育注册西汉姆-betway官网betway官网手机-首页正规买球APP排行_目前最好的足彩APPbetway体育注册西汉姆顶级信誉博彩平台授权投注网站,网上娱乐游戏、真人体验!登录注册会员下载手机端APP,首存赠送100%!betway官网betway官网手机

betway体育注册西汉姆-betway官网betway官网手机-首页

betway体育注册西汉姆-betway官网betway官网手机-首页

Zipkin架构简介

ZipkiZipkin架构简介n根本概念

  1. Span:根本作业单元,一次链路调用Zipkin架构简介就会创立一个Span
  2. Trace:一组Span的调集,表明一条调用链路。举个比如:当时存在服务A调用服务B然后调用服务Zipkin架构简介C,这个A->B->C的链路便是一条Trace,而每个服务例如B便是一个Span,如果在服务B中另起2个线程别离调用了D、E,那么D、E便是Zipkin架构简介B的子Span

Zipkin架构

先看一下架构图

其间左面部分代表了客户端别离为:

  1. InstrumentedClient:运用了Zipkin客户端东西的服务调用方
  2. InstrumentedServer:运用了Zipkin客户端东西的服务供给方
  3. Non-InstrumentedServer:未运用Trace东西的服务供给方,Zipkin架构简介当然还或许存在未运用东西的调用方
  4. 总结:一个调用链路是贯穿InstrumentedClient->InstrumentedServer的,每通过一个服务都会以Span的方式通过Tra111111nsport把通过本身的恳求上报的Zipkin服务端中

右边线框内代表了Zipkin的服务端,其间各组件的功用如下:

  1. UI:供给web页面,用来展现Zipkin中的调用链和体系111111依靠联系等
  2. Collector:对各个客户端露出,担任承受调用数据,支撑HTTP、MQ等
  3. Storage:担任与各个存储适配后存储数据,支撑内存,MySQL,ES等
  4. API:为web界面供给查询存储中的数据的接口

重视大众号:Java学习录,检查更多Spring、SpringBoot、SprinZipkin架构简介gCloud源码解析Zipkin架构简介系列文章